This next one was made with my new Top Note SU Die and the Big Shot. I cut out 2 layers and trimmed the red paper along the perforation line so the white frames it...

The swirlies on this were glittered with some stickles after I glued them down.

Recipe.
Stamps: Best Yet, Holiday Best SU!
Card: Kraft, SU Whisper White.
Paper: Christmas Cocoa Speciality (SU!)
Ink: SU! Real Red.
Ribbon is SU! organza, Sissix Swirls Die, SU! small oval and small scalloped oval punches. Fiskars border punch.
